Great Barrier Reef, on the way to Green Island
Day 2: We took a 1.5 hour boat ride to The Great Barrier Reef and Green Island. The Great Barrier Reef is one of the seven wonders of the natural world and the only living thing visible from space. We spent the day on Green Island enjoying swimming, snorkeling and wandering around the island. We also took two boat tours: on a glass bottom boat and on a semi-submerged boat. Both allowed us to see vast amounts of fish and coral without having to go on a dive.
